I was in Sixth Grade. Sister did not tell us anything, just acted shaken up, finished day. Walking to train station to go home, I passed Chestnut Hill Hospital, saw the flag at half-mast. Thought, maybe the President was killed. When I got to station, the kids who got rides to the station told me about it. Went home and my mother had it on TV.
I think we watched a different network which did not cover Oswald's shooting live.

In a Vermont 1-room school, all 8 grades. I was in the 8th grade, in reading class at the front of the room. The teacher's husband walked in with a radio and put it on the teacher's desk. We listened and learned he had died.

In the next few days, I remember talking with my friends about it. We thought that Russia would take us over - no kidding - it was in the middle of the cold war and we always heard Air Force jets scrambling out of Plattsburgh NY AFB and wondered what was happening.
